Smiths Group's John Crane division has secured B-BBEE Level One status in South Africa, a regulatory compliance milestone that unlocks preferential procurement access and enhances local market positioning. This certification reflects alignment with South African economic empowerment requirements and signals management's commitment to sustained regional operations.

The achievement carries strategic implications for long-term localization and customer support infrastructure in a key emerging market. B-BBEE Level One status typically improves competitive bidding advantages in government and corporate contracts, creating a structural tailwind for revenue growth in the region. This is particularly relevant for flow control and industrial equipment providers serving energy, mining, and infrastructure sectors.

The announcement underscores Smiths Group's broader geographic diversification strategy beyond developed markets. South Africa remains a material jurisdiction for industrial services, and regulatory credibility through B-BBEE compliance reduces execution risk for future expansion and contract renewals in the region.
